#966766 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#966766 is composed of 58.8% red, 40.4%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.3% magenta, 32%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 1.3 degrees, a saturation of 19% and a lightness of 49.4%. #966766 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cecc with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#966766 color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.

#966766 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#966766 has RGB values of R:150, G:103,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.32,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9856870.

Shades and Tints of #966766

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0707 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#966766

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#837a79 is the less saturated color, while #f70a05 is the most saturated one.
